2023年全球Deepfake人工智慧市場價值約3.9015億美元,預計在2024-2032年預測期間將以超過44.56%的健康成長率成長。 Deepfake AI 是指利用人工智慧和機器學習技術來創建高度真實且令人信服的音訊、視訊和影像的數位偽造品。這些合成媒體通常是使用生成對抗網路(GAN)等技術生成的,其中兩個神經網路競爭以產生越來越令人信服的假貨。 Deepfakes 可以操縱個人的外表、動作和聲音,讓他們看起來在說或做一些他們實際上從未做過的事情。雖然這項技術在娛樂和創意藝術方面具有潛在的應用,但它也帶來了重大的道德和安全挑戰,包括錯誤訊息的傳播、身分盜竊和侵犯隱私。

全球 Deepfake 人工智慧市場是由受操縱媒體(或“deepfakes”)激增推動的,對數位身分構成重大威脅,推動了對複雜檢測工具的需求。隨著深度造假變得越來越令人信服,保護個人和機構免受身分盜竊、詐騙和錯誤資訊侵害的需求也日益強烈。這種需求促進了旨在創建和檢測深度贗品的尖端人工智慧工具的開發,從而導致市場迅速擴大。公司和政府正在分配大量資源來增強數位安全性和真實性,從而推動市場成長。此外,檢測供應商、研究機構和政府之間的合作為減輕深度造假風險提供了重要機會。此外,區塊鏈技術為追蹤和驗證數位內容提供了有前途的解決方案,有助於提供更強大的方法來維護數位完整性和公眾信任。然而,數位媒體操縱技術的快速發展將阻礙 2024-2032 年預測期內市場的整體需求。

全球 Deepfake 人工智慧市場研究涵蓋的關鍵區域包括亞太地區、北美、歐洲、拉丁美洲和世界其他地區。 2023 年,亞太地區預計將在預測期內經歷 Deepfake 人工智慧市場的最高成長率。東南亞與深度造假相關的犯罪事件不斷增加,加上該地區數位金融交易量龐大,推動了對有效檢測解決方案的需求。隨著該地區各國政府加強監管深度造假,這些技術的市場預計將蓬勃發展。此外,預計北美市場在 2024 年至 2032 年的預測期內將以最快的速度發展。

Global Deepfake AI Market is valued at approximately USD 390.15 million in 2023 and is anticipated to grow with a healthy growth rate of more than 44.56% over the forecast period 2024-2032. Deepfake AI refers to the use of artificial intelligence and machine learning technologies to create highly realistic and convincing digital forgeries of audio, video, and images. These synthetic media are often generated using techniques such as generative adversarial networks (GANs), where two neural networks compete to produce increasingly convincing fakes. Deepfakes can manipulate the appearance, movements, and voices of individuals, making them appear to say or do things they never actually did. While this technology has potential applications in entertainment and creative arts, it also poses significant ethical and security challenges, including the spread of misinformation, identity theft, and privacy violations.

The Global Deepfake AI Market is driven by surge in manipulated media, or 'deepfakes,' poses a significant threat to digital identity, driving demand for sophisticated detection tools. As deepfakes become increasingly convincing, the need to protect individuals and institutions from identity theft, scams, and misinformation intensifies. This demand catalyzes the development of cutting-edge AI tools aimed at both the creation and detection of deepfakes, resulting in a rapidly expanding market. Companies and governments are allocating substantial resources to enhance digital security and authenticity, which in turn propels market growth. Moreover, collaborative efforts between detection vendors, research institutes, and governments present significant opportunities to mitigate deepfake risks. Additionally, blockchain technology offers promising solutions for tracking and verifying digital content, contributing to a more robust approach to safeguarding digital integrity and public trust. However, rapid evolution of digital media manipulation techniques is going to impede the overall demand for the market during the forecast period 2024-2032.

The key regions considered for Global Deepfake AI Market study includes Asia Pacific, North America, Europe, Latin America, and Rest of the World. In 2023, the Asia Pacific region is poised to experience the highest growth rate in the deepfake AI market during the forecast period. The increasing incidence of deepfake-related crimes in Southeast Asia, coupled with the region's high volume of digital financial transactions, drives demand for effective detection solutions. As governments in this region intensify efforts to regulate deepfakes, the market for these technologies is expected to flourish. Furthermore, the market in North America is anticipated to develop at the fastest rate over the forecast period 2024-2032.
